Result Round Up – Saturday 15th April 2017.

The 1st XI narrowly lost 3 – 2 to Tooting Bec FC of the Surrey Elite League in a competitive Friendly match at the Hub in an early Kick-Off today.

 

The Hosts took the lead in the 29th Minute before the Ruts hit a quickfire double to secure the half time lead. Firstly, Ollie Hicks conjured a delightful leveller in the 34th minute following clever footwork and a deft finish and then in the 37th minute Paul Whitthread pounced at the end of a decent move to put the Ruts 2 – 1 ahead.

 

Tooting replied with a two goal rally of their own very early in the second half and despite chances for both sides to score again, the match was played out, with the final score 3 – 2 to Tooting Bec.

‘The Long Good Friday’ 21 years ago on Good Friday 1996. What a day!

 

Old Rutlishians 3-0 Kingston Albion
Scorers: Jimmy Wilkes (2), Steve Jupp
5th April 1996 KDFL Teck Senior Cup Final
By Gavin Lennard

This was a great game from 21 years ago on Good Friday 1996. It was memorable for a number of reasons. Firstly, it was the biggest game in the Ruts short football history (then six years into our reformation). Secondly, it was the KDFL Centenary year and their showpiece Cup Final was played at a modern Kingstonian FC (normally at Hampton in those days). Thirdly, we were the complete underdogs really, our opponents Kingston Albion were a very good side and without doubt the strongest club in the KDFL at the time. This was our first season in the Premier Division and they had spanked us 4-1 earlier in the campaign and we held on for a 0-0 home draw the week before the final.

Anyway, the team played out of their skins that day and centre half Steve Jupp headed in a first half free kick from player/manager Gary Newcome’s free kick. Then young Whizz-Kid Jimmy Wilkes notched two stunning second half goals to secure a fine 3-0 victory.

A massive party ensued throughout the rest of the day, starting at the K’s bar, taking in the Old Ruts and finally onto Wimbledon and the Curry Royal – truly awesome.
